svn commit: r419418 - in head/print/fontforge: . files
Pawel Pekala
pawel at FreeBSD.org
Sun Jul 31 22:41:34 UTC 2016
Author: pawel
Date: Sun Jul 31 22:41:33 2016
New Revision: 419418
URL: https://svnweb.freebsd.org/changeset/ports/419418
Log:
- Update to version 20160404
- Register package indirect dependencies
PR: 211463
Submitted by: Naram Qashat (maintainer)
Deleted:
head/print/fontforge/files/patch-configure.ac
Modified:
head/print/fontforge/Makefile
head/print/fontforge/distinfo
Modified: head/print/fontforge/Makefile
==============================================================================
--- head/print/fontforge/Makefile Sun Jul 31 21:45:36 2016 (r419417)
+++ head/print/fontforge/Makefile Sun Jul 31 22:41:33 2016 (r419418)
@@ -2,10 +2,9 @@
# $FreeBSD$
PORTNAME= fontforge
-PORTVERSION= 20150824
-PORTREVISION= 2
+PORTVERSION= 20160404
CATEGORIES= print
-DISTFILES= ${DISTNAME}${EXTRACT_SUFX}
+DISTFILES= # Empty but needed because of the freetype distfile
MAINTAINER= cyberbotx at cyberbotx.com
COMMENT= Type 1/TrueType/OpenType/bitmap font editor
@@ -21,17 +20,18 @@ LIB_DEPENDS= libuninameslist.so:textproc
libgif.so:graphics/giflib \
libspiro.so:graphics/libspiro \
libfreetype.so:print/freetype2 \
- libltdl.so:devel/libltdl
+ libltdl.so:devel/libltdl \
+ libfontconfig.so:x11-fonts/fontconfig
USE_GITHUB= yes
-USES= autoreconf:build desktop-file-utils execinfo gettext gmake iconv \
- jpeg libtool pkgconfig python shared-mime-info shebangfix \
- compiler
+USES= autoreconf:build compiler desktop-file-utils execinfo gettext \
+ gmake iconv jpeg libtool pkgconfig python readline:port \
+ shared-mime-info shebangfix
SHEBANG_FILES= pycontrib/gdraw/__init__.py \
pycontrib/gdraw/gdraw.py
-USE_XORG= ice x11 xi xkbui
-USE_GNOME= glib20 gtk20 libxml2 pango
+USE_XORG= ice sm x11 xi xkbui xft
+USE_GNOME= cairo glib20 gtk20 libxml2 pango
CONFIGURE_ARGS= --enable-tile-path --enable-gtk2-use
CPPFLAGS+= -I${LOCALBASE}/include
@@ -50,7 +50,6 @@ FREETYPE_DESC= Include freetype's intern
PYTHON_CONFIGURE_ENABLE= python-scripting python-extension
-CAIRO_USE= GNOME=cairo
CAIRO_CONFIGURE_WITH= cairo
.include <bsd.port.options.mk>
@@ -62,7 +61,7 @@ MASTER_SITES+= http://savannah.nongnu.or
http://www.funet.fi/pub/mirrors/ftp.freetype.org/freetype2/:freetype \
http://ftp.sunet.se/pub/text-processing/freetype/freetype2/:freetype \
ftp://ftp.freetype.org/freetype/freetype2/:freetype
-FREETYPE_VERSION= 2.6.2
+FREETYPE_VERSION= 2.6.3
FREETYPE_SRC= freetype-${FREETYPE_VERSION}.tar.bz2
DISTFILES+= ${FREETYPE_SRC:C/$/:freetype/}
CONFIGURE_ARGS+= --enable-freetype-debugger=${WRKDIR}/freetype-${FREETYPE_VERSION}
Modified: head/print/fontforge/distinfo
==============================================================================
--- head/print/fontforge/distinfo Sun Jul 31 21:45:36 2016 (r419417)
+++ head/print/fontforge/distinfo Sun Jul 31 22:41:33 2016 (r419418)
@@ -1,4 +1,5 @@
-SHA256 (fontforge-fontforge-20150824_GH0.tar.gz) = 28ab2471cb010c1fa75b8ab8191a1dded81fe1e9490aa5ff6ab4706a4c78ff27
-SIZE (fontforge-fontforge-20150824_GH0.tar.gz) = 25030387
-SHA256 (freetype-2.6.2.tar.bz2) = baf6bdef7cdcc12ac270583f76ef245efe936267dbecef835f02a3409fcbb892
-SIZE (freetype-2.6.2.tar.bz2) = 1767940
+TIMESTAMP = 1467049926
+SHA256 (freetype-2.6.3.tar.bz2) = 371e707aa522acf5b15ce93f11183c725b8ed1ee8546d7b3af549863045863a2
+SIZE (freetype-2.6.3.tar.bz2) = 1753083
+SHA256 (fontforge-fontforge-20160404_GH0.tar.gz) = 1cc5646fccba2e5af8f1b6c1d0d6d7b6082d9546aefed2348d6c0ed948324796
+SIZE (fontforge-fontforge-20160404_GH0.tar.gz) = 25056793
More information about the svn-ports-head
mailing list